Signature Craving

The local go‑to? Casa Di Pizza.
Wood‑fired classics like the Margherita land with a light char and clean basil hit.
The Italian Meat Deluxe satisfies without going greasy, while the Hawaiian‑with‑a‑twist (pineapple, jalapeños, smoked ham) brings sweet‑heat balance.
Here’s the kicker: it gets busy on weekends—book or order ahead.
Ask for chili oil on the side and thank us later.

FAQ

Q: Which pizza places in Officer are open after 9:30 pm? Most close around 10 pm, with later hours Thu–Sat. Check live hours on Google before you go and call ahead if you’re cutting it close.

Q: Does Casa Di Pizza deliver to Officer South (3809)? Yes—delivery covers most of 3809, but boundaries shift. Pop your address into their checkout or call to confirm your street is in zone.

Q: Where can I grab pizza near Officer train station? Mamma Mia’s on Railway Ave is the quick walk option for post-commute pick‑ups.

Q: Who does gluten-free bases in Officer? Pizza Paradise offers a gluten‑free base. Ask about separate prep to manage cross‑contact if you’re coeliac.

Q: Is vegan cheese available for pizza in Officer? Yes—Casa Di Pizza and Pizza Paradise have plant‑based cheese and stacked veg combos.

Q: What’s the best value large pizza under $20 in Officer? Mr. Pizza and Takeaway Delight often run large specials under $20. Prices shift with deals—check boards or apps.

Q: Do any Officer pizzerias use a wood‑fired oven? Yes—Casa Di Pizza runs a wood‑fired oven for that light char and airy crust.

Q: Can I pre‑order 10+ pizzas for a kids’ party in Officer? Most shops can—Pizza Paradise does bulk orders with advance notice. Call the day before for smoother timing.

Q: Is there outdoor seating for pizza in Officer? Casa Di Pizza has a small outdoor area—good for mild evenings but limited tables.

Q: Do Officer pizza shops do half/half and custom toppings? Common, yes. Mr. Pizza and Mamma Mia’s offer half/half; extras like jalapeños or anchovies are easy add‑ons.

Q: Which delivery apps actually service 3809? DoorDash, Uber Eats, and Menulog cover most of Officer. Some venues are cheaper direct—compare fees before ordering.

Q: How do Officer pizza prices compare to Berwick and Pakenham? Officer is generally cheaper than Berwick and similar to Pakenham, with most pizzas landing around $15–$30.
